# Extinction Map of the Galactic center: OGLE-II Galactic bulge fields This directory contain the extinction maps of OGLE-II Galactic bulge fields. You can use the extinction maps (text fromat) or Perl script to get the extinction value. **Note: The user should be aware of the zero point of the extinction may be non-accurate. (see the paper) Contents: EVImaps/sc*.map.gz # extinction maps for bul_sc* field # Columns are as follows; # n X Y E(V-I) err AV err AI err Nall cut VIsdev NRC cut VIsdev grp # #1 n : bin number #2 X : x axis of bin #3 Y : x axis of bin #4,5 E(V-I) err: Reddening and error in magnitude #6,7 AV err: V-band extinction and error in magnitude #8 9 AI err: I-band extinction and error in magnitude #10 Nall : Number of all stars in this bin #11 cut : Number of all stars in this bin after 2 sigma clip #12 VIsdev : Standard deviation in I-V color of all stars in this bin #13 NRC : Number of RCG stars in this bin #14 cut : Number of RCG stars in this bin after 2 sigma clip #15 VIsdev : Standard deviation in I-V color of all stars in this bin #16 grp : Flag. Group number to which this bin belongs for normal bin # but negative value for the bin with a problem (see the text) # Note these err are relative. # additional zero point errors are given at the end of files # E(V-I)0err= 0.0244 AV0err= 0.0480 AI0err= 0.0236 # Other informations such as bin size are also at the end of files bin/radec2xy # Linux machine Exec. code to transform (RA,Dec) to (x,y) bin/xsplin2 # Linux machine Exec. code for interpolation bin_sun/radec2xy # Sun machine Exec. code to transform (RA,Dec) to (x,y) get_EVI_xy.pl # Perl script to get extinction by (x,y) pixel coordinate get_EVI_xy_interp.pl # with interpolation get_EVI_RADec.pl # by (RA, Dec) coordinate. Note change the path in the script # (5th line) to bin_sun/radec2xy for Sun machine get_EVI_RADec_interp.pl # with interpolation #----------------------Examples how to use Perl script----------------------------------------------- # get_EVI_xy.pl can be used on any machine # get_EVI_RADec.pl can be used on Linux machine and on Sun by changing the path in the script # (5th line) to bin_sun/radec2xy # Scripts with interpolation can be used on Linux machine only. # We don't recommend to use a interpolation for a lot of stars because it is slow. get_EVI_xy.pl 1 1023.8 4096.3 # bul_sc1 (x,y)=(1023.8, 4096.3) get_EVI_RADec.pl 1 18:02:32.5 -29:57:41 # bul_sc1 (RA, Dec)=(18:02:32.5, -29:57:41) #Both will give the same answer: 13 56 0.7240 0.0114 1.4221 0.0232 0.6981 0.0125 0.0244 0.0480 0.0236 30 #Values represent: X Y E(V-I) err AV err AI err E(V-I)0err AV0err AI0err grp get_EVI_xy_interp.pl 1 1023.8 4096.3 get_EVI_RADec_interp.pl 1 18:02:32.5 -29:57:41 #Both will give same answer: 13 56 0.7240 0.0114 1.4221 0.0232 0.6981 0.0125 0.0244 0.0480 0.0236 30 :ACTUAL 13 56 0.7428 0.0114 1.4591 0.0232 0.7163 0.0125 0.0244 0.0480 0.0236 30 :INTERP #First line the is same as in above example. #Second line is with values given by interpolation.
